Has Anyone Else Started Seeing Pack Trailers Like Fast Food Adds?
Alright, hear me out. So, the "Discover University" trailer just dropped today. They edited the trailer to make the pack look as good and exciting as possible. However, the only thing I found myself thinking looking at all of the features they showcased was, "You know it's not going to play like that when you get it."
It's the same feeling as watching a commercial for a fast food restaurant. They do everything in their power, from dropping clear glycerin on the vegetables to make them look kissed by the morning dew to using straight-up substitutes for the actual foods that look better when filmed, to make it look delicious. But, if you've eaten from that restaurant before, you know darn well that the veggies will be limp and dry, the burger will not fill the bun, only half (at best) of those fries will be crispy while the other half are floppy with grease, and your sandwich will be squished and lopsided. After the first 12 years of your life, you expect to feel that way about fast food commercials. Getting the same feeling about the reveal trailer for a game is just...depressing.
